Who We Are
For over 20 years, Ruth & Naomi’s Mission has been a beacon of hope in Chilliwack—serving meals, offering shelter, and supporting recovery. Our supportive housing programs meet people where they are, offering a stable foundation for growth and transformation. At Interchange, we provide safe and supportive housing for individuals seeking or maintaining abstinence, and we walk with them every step of the way.
